Flame of life
One night was spent in a Forest of Cherry trees,
Wandered next day through a deep valley,
Along a path covered by Autumn leaves
The evening was spent in a large Fir Wood,
`Neath a great tree , which wore in it`s branches,
The night , like dark flames in thick wild hair,
Here a fire was kindled while the great tree keptguard,
Immobile , silent , lit with a flame at the heart of it,
Like a Pagen God or an old Indian Chieftain ,
Assuming a savage beauty,
when the flames fluttered and fell,
While round about darkness reigned ,
like empty space eternity,
Yet within the flames created,
a circle all was mystery,
The flame a life in itself
Between darkness and burning light.
